Why RV Moisture Control Is Vital for Your Health
Small living spaces trap moisture incredibly fast. Cooking, showering, and even normal breathing in a 200-square-foot rig can easily release over a gallon of water vapor into the air every day. Without active management, this airborne water migrates to the coldest surfaces, creating hidden pools of condensation behind cabinets, under cushions, and inside wall cavities.
This trapped dampness creates a perfect breeding ground for toxic black mold and mildew. Mold spores colonize soft surfaces rapidly, leading to respiratory issues, severe allergies, and long-term health complications for the inhabitants. Because RV walls are thin and often lack the robust vapor barriers of traditional homes, early prevention is the only reliable way to keep your living air clean and safe.
Furthermore, excess humidity directly threatens the structural integrity of your mobile home. Water damage rots wood studs, rusts steel frames, and causes expensive fiberglass wall delamination. Controlling your interior climate is not just about daily comfort; it is a vital practice for protecting both your physical health and your financial investment in the rig.
Compact Dehumidifier – Pro Breeze Electric Mini
Active moisture extraction is crucial for small spaces during high-humidity seasons when passive ventilation cannot keep up. A compact thermoelectric dehumidifier works silently to pull water directly from the air in confined zones like bathrooms or small bedrooms. By lowering the relative humidity in these specific trouble spots, you prevent the damp air from migrating throughout the rest of your rig.
The Pro Breeze Electric Mini is the ideal choice for small-scale RV applications due to its efficient Peltier technology. This design eliminates the need for a noisy compressor, allowing the unit to run quietly in the background while you sleep or work. It features an automatic shutoff sensor that triggers when the water tank reaches capacity, preventing messy overflows while in transit.
- Extraction Capacity: 9 ounces of water per day
- Tank Volume: 16 ounces (500ml)
- Power Consumption: 23 watts
- Operating Technology: Thermoelectric Peltier cooling
Before purchasing, keep in mind that thermoelectric units are highly dependent on the ambient room temperature. They perform best in warm, humid conditions above 59°F and will lose efficiency rapidly in cold winter weather. The low power draw makes it incredibly easy to run off a small solar setup, but the water tank must be manually emptied every few days.
This compact unit is perfect for van conversions, truck campers, and small travel trailers under 20 feet. It is not powerful enough to manage the moisture levels of a large double-slide fifth wheel or to combat heavy winter condensation on its own.
Desiccant Dehumidifier – Ivation 13-Pint Small-Area
Standard compressor dehumidifiers struggle when temperatures drop below 60°F because their internal coils freeze over. When cold-weather RVing, a desiccant dehumidifier is essential because it uses a heated chemical rotor to absorb moisture regardless of the ambient room temperature. This process ensures consistent drying performance even during freezing winter nights.
The Ivation 13-Pint Small-Area Desiccant Dehumidifier stands out because of its exceptional performance in low temperatures. Unlike compressor models, it exhausts slightly warmed air, which helps take the chill out of your RV interior while removing moisture. It also features a continuous drainage option, allowing you to route a hose directly into your grey tank or sink.
- Extraction Capacity: 13 pints of water per day
- Minimum Operating Temp: 33°F
- Power Consumption: 300 watts (Low) / 460 watts (High)
- Weight: 11.1 pounds
The primary trade-off with desiccant technology is power consumption. Drawing up to 460 watts, this unit requires a robust lithium battery bank with a large inverter, a generator, or a reliable shore power connection to run continuously. The internal heater also adds warmth to the space, which is a major benefit in winter but can be undesirable during hot summer months.
This unit is the ultimate solution for four-season RVers living in cold, damp climates like the Pacific Northwest. It is not recommended for strict summer boondockers or those with minimal solar and battery capacities who cannot support the high electrical demand.

Wireless Dehumidifier – Eva-Dry E-333 Renewable Mini
Tight micro-climates like spice cabinets, under-sink storage, and gear lockers need moisture protection but completely lack electrical outlets. Wireless, renewable dehumidifiers offer a safe, cord-free way to dry out these dark zones without messy liquids. They rely on silica gel beads that lock away water vapor internally, preventing mold where traditional products cannot fit.
The Eva-Dry E-333 is a standout product because it uses non-toxic silica gel that is completely renewable. The front window features color-changing indicator beads that shift from orange (dry) to green (wet) to let you know when the unit is saturated. To renew the device, you simply fold down the hidden plug and connect it to an AC outlet outside the cabinet to dry it out.
- Coverage Area: Up to 333 cubic feet
- Active Ingredient: Non-toxic silica gel beads
- Lifespan: Up to 10 years
- Recharge Time: 12 to 15 hours
Regenerating the silica gel requires plugging the unit into a standard AC wall outlet, during which it releases the trapped moisture back into the air as heat. For this reason, you should always plug the unit in to recharge in a well-ventilated area or an outdoor outlet, rather than inside your closed RV. It takes up to 15 hours to dry out completely, requiring patience and planning.
This wireless option is perfect for small, unventilated cabinets, vanity drawers, and electronics storage lockers. It is not suitable for open RV cabins or any area with high, active airflow, as the silica gel will saturate too quickly to be practical.
Mattress Underlay – Hypervent Condensation Matting
Human bodies release up to a pint of moisture every single night through sweat and respiration. In an RV, the cold plywood platform beneath your mattress meets the warm mattress above, creating a thermal bridge that breeds mold underneath your bed. A mattress underlay is a structural necessity that prevents this moisture from rotting your mattress and bed platform.
Hypervent Condensation Matting is a specialized mesh layer that creates a permanent 3/4-inch elevated air gap beneath your mattress. Its rigid polymer loop design easily supports the weight of sleepers while allowing warm cabin air to flow freely underneath the bed. This continuous airflow dries out any moisture that migrates through the mattress before it can pool and create mold.
- Thickness: 0.75 inches
- Material: Spun polymer loop bonded to a breathable fabric layer
- Weight Support: Up to 100 pounds per square foot
- Sizing: Sold by the running foot (typically 39 inches wide)
While highly effective, the matting is stiff and can be difficult to cut to shape without heavy-duty utility shears. The cut edges of the polymer loops can be scratchy, so wrapping the perimeter with duct tape is recommended to protect your hands and your mattress fabric. It is also a relatively expensive specialty material, though it lasts for the lifetime of your RV.
This is a mandatory upgrade for any full-time RVer sleeping on a solid plywood platform, especially in cold climates. It is unnecessary if your bed frame already utilizes open wooden slats that allow natural bottom-up ventilation.

Reflective Insulation – Reflectix Double Reflective
Condensation forms when warm, moist interior air collides with cold surfaces, most notably single-pane RV glass windows. Creating a thermal barrier on your windows prevents this temperature drop, stopping gaseous water vapor from turning into liquid runoff. Reflective insulation panels are an easy, cost-effective way to isolate these cold glass surfaces from your living space.
Reflectix Double Reflective Insulation uses two layers of 99% pure reflective aluminum foil bonded to an internal layer of industrial bubble wrapping. This lightweight barrier reflects up to 97% of radiant heat, keeping your window glass warmer during the winter. It is highly flexible, water-resistant, and can be cut easily with scissors to create custom-fit window inserts.
- Material: Polyethylene bubbles sandwiched between reflective foil layers
- Thickness: 5/16 inches
- Temperature Range: -60°F to 180°F
- R-Value: Varies based on installation (up to R-4.2 with air space)
While excellent for thermal protection, Reflectix completely blocks natural light, turning your RV interior dark if used on all windows simultaneously. If moisture is already trapped behind a poorly fitted panel, it can still condense on the glass, meaning you must cut the panels for a tight friction-fit inside the window frame.
This product is highly recommended for winter RVers and off-grid boondockers looking to eliminate sweating on large windshields and side windows. It is not a standalone dehumidifying solution, but rather a tool to eliminate the cold surfaces where condensation occurs.

How to Calculate the Right Dehumidifier Capacity
Dehumidifier sizing for residential homes does not translate directly to mobile living. Standard units are rated by how many pints of water they can extract from the air in a 24-hour period. Because RVs have minimal insulation and high air exchange rates, you must calculate capacity based on both the physical volume of your rig and the climate you are traveling through.
To find your baseline requirement, calculate the interior square footage of your RV. * Small rigs (under 150 sq ft): Typically require a compact unit pulling 0.5 to 1 pint of water daily. * Medium rigs (150 to 300 sq ft): Benefit from a unit rated for 10 to 15 pints per day. * Large rigs (over 300 sq ft): Often require a robust 20- to 30-pint capacity unit, especially in coastal regions.
Always remember that manufacturer extraction ratings are calculated under ideal laboratory conditions, typically 80°F and 60% relative humidity. In the real world, cooler temperatures make water extraction much more difficult for compressor units. To offset this loss of efficiency, always buy a dehumidifier with a slightly higher capacity than your raw square footage suggests.
Daily Habits to Prevent Condensation in Small Spaces
Technology is only half of the moisture control equation; your daily habits play an equally massive role. Simple behavioral changes can drastically reduce the amount of water vapor you introduce into your RV air. Always open your ceiling vent fan and run it on high before you boil water, wash dishes, or take a hot shower.
Manage your wet gear diligently. Never hang soaked towels, jackets, or laundry to dry inside the RV cabin, as a single wet bath towel can release up to a pint of water into your air as it dries. Use a squeegee to scrape wet shower walls down the drain immediately after bathing, and wipe down your kitchen sink after washing dishes.
Finally, keep your storage spaces breathing. Leave your closet, pantry, and under-sink doors slightly cracked during freezing nights to prevent dead zones of cold, stagnant air from forming. Keeping your furniture and mattress pushed slightly away from exterior walls also encourages healthy air circulation, preventing hidden condensation from taking hold.
